Post Offices
Denton's village Post Office is open from 9.00 a.m. to 1.00 p.m. every Thursday in the Vestry of the Chapel at Chapel Corner. A wide range of PO services are provided. Teas and coffees are available so visiting the post office can be a social occasion as well.
Other post offices are located at:
- Bungay, Earsham Street - 9.00-5.30 Monday to Friday, 9.00-1.00 Saturday.
- Harleston, The Thoroughfare - 9.00-5.30 Monday to Friday, 9.00-12.30 Saturday.
Postal Collection Times
The last collection times at the four postboxes in the village are:
- Chapel Corner: Weekdays - 15.20, Saturday - 09.00
- Norwich/Darrow Green Road Junction: Weekdays - 09.00, Saturday - 08.30
- Church Corner: Weekdays - 09.00, Saturday - 09.45
- Danacre Road: Weekdays - 09.00, Saturday - 07.30
It should be noted that all the postboxes in the village are part of the Ipswich (IP) postal area. Mail going to an NR postcode, particularly second-class, will probably get there quicker if placed in a Norwich area box. The nearest of these is at Upgate Street in Bedingham (Collection 16.00, Saturday 07.45).
Later collections are available from Bungay PO (NR) at 18.00 (12.00 Saturday) and Harleston PO (IP) at 17.30 (12.00 Saturday).
